Output e81067954efbbe20f5468c424d6d9cca30f65e545dca147fed11bfd249774415:1

value
531151
script pubkey
OP_0 OP_PUSHBYTES_20 25934ad9b7a15b21cc5ff57ce2fa7d51d60f7c69
address
tb1qykf54kdh59djrnzl747w97na28tq7lrfaych5y
transaction
e81067954efbbe20f5468c424d6d9cca30f65e545dca147fed11bfd249774415
confirmations
82516
spent
true